Top 5 Shoot'em Up Games on iOS in Ghana: Q1 2022
Discover the performance of the top 5 shoot'em up games on iOS in Ghana during Q1 2022, including download trends and revenue insights.
The first quarter of 2022 saw varying performance trends among the top 5 shoot'em up games on iOS in Ghana. Here’s a detailed look at how these games fared in terms of downloads, revenue, and active users.
Archero from HABBY experienced fluctuating weekly revenue, peaking at around $56 in late March. Downloads showed a notable spike in mid-January, reaching 214, while active users saw a steady presence, peaking at 492 in late January.
Road Riot Combat Racing by Titan Mobile LLC had modest weekly revenue, fluctuating around $5 to $11 throughout the quarter. The downloads were minimal, with only a few instances of activity, and active user data was not available.
Galaxy Attack: Alien Shooter from ABI GLOBAL LTD. saw a decline in weekly revenue, starting at $30 in early January and dropping to $2 by the end of March. However, downloads were strong, peaking at 765 in mid-March. Active users increased significantly, reaching 5.4K in the same period.
Mr Autofire by Lightheart Entertainment had low weekly revenue, typically under $10. Downloads peaked at 41 in early January but showed a decline throughout the quarter. Active users also saw a downward trend, decreasing from 140 in early January to 66 by the end of March.
Fastlane: Fun Car Racing Game from Space Ape Ltd maintained consistent, albeit low, weekly revenue around $1 to $6. Downloads peaked at 24 in late February. Active users showed a slight decline from 48 in early January to 40 by the end of March.
